#6398fb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6398fb is composed of 38.8% red, 59.6%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.6% cyan, 39.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 219.1 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 68.6%. #6398fb color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#0031f7.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#6398fb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6398fb has RGB values of R:99, G:152,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 6527227.

Shades and Tints of #6398fb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000610 is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6398fb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adaeb1 is the less saturated color, while #6398fb is the most saturated one.
